4. ASUS Vivo AiO V241IC: Best performance in the budget segment

ASUS Vivo AiO V241IC

Typical office all in one with an average performance level. The processor is 4-core and quite efficient, but only 4 GB of RAM is added to the database, which does not allow you to run more than one application or install Windows 10. However, an increase to 8 GB is provided, so the upgrade will help solve the problem. There is a discrete video card, but you still won’t be able to play good games due to the small amount of RAM. Another problem often mentioned in reviews is the slowness of the HDD, so you should immediately think about replacing it with an SSD drive. As for the pluses, users note the build quality, stylish design, excellent color reproduction of the display, and very high sound quality of the built-in speakers.

3. Lenovo IdeaCentre A340

Lenovo IdeaCentre A340

The classic representative of the budget segment of all in one with a screen diagonal of 23-24 inches. It is focused on working in the office, so it gets a good SSD in the database, but only 4 GB of RAM with the possibility of doubling it during the upgrade. The display is built on a VA matrix and offers a decent level of picture quality, although the backlight’s headroom is frustrating for many. It should be borne in mind that the model comes without a pre-installed OS, as well as a wired keyboard and mouse. However, this is partly trifles, but the noisy operation of the cooling system is much more frustrating. Also, in the reviews, they often complain about the small number of USB ports – there are only 4 of them, which greatly limits the need to connect a large number of peripherals.

2. Acer Aspire C24-960: Best compact all in one

Acer Aspire C24-960

Not a bad budget-level office candy bar with a cute ultra-thin body, but with a stand, to the quality of which many users have complaints. Based on a relatively fresh 2-core processor with a boost from 2.1 to 4.1 GHz. However, the integrated graphics and only 4 GB of RAM in the base will not allow you to enjoy games. As compensation, there are excellent upgrade opportunities: the RAM can be expanded up to 16 GB, and the base media can be easily changed for something better. The screen here is standard, with a diagonal of almost 24 full inches, but is built on a TN + film matrix, so it has some restrictions on viewing angles and color clarity, but in general it is quite suitable for typical office tasks or comfortable surfing the Internet.

5. ASUS Zen AiO ZN242GD: Entry-level gaming hardware. Best Drive Bundle

ASUS Zen AiO ZN242GD

An interesting option for those looking for a productive system for work and occasional rest in games. It should be remembered that the capabilities of the cooling system are not designed for long-term operation of the candy bar under high loads, so it is better not to launch demanding games or limit the time. In general, this model is a perfectly balanced version with a high-quality discrete video card with its own 4 GB of memory, and an excellent 24-inch display, giving out a rich picture with natural colors. The downgraded rating is solely due to a weak cooling system, a webcam installed for the show, and minor ergonomics problems. For example, most buyers immediately change a regular mouse for something more convenient.

4. Lenovo AIO V530-24ICB: largest amount of RAM

Lenovo AIO V530-24ICB

A very productive candy bar with an eye on the role of an entry-level gaming model. Onboard is a 6-core processor with overclocking from 1.8 to 3.4 GHz, and AMD discrete with 2 GB of video memory, and 16 GB of RAM with the ability to add the same amount to the second slot. The picture is completed by a reliable SSD with sufficient capacity for the OS and all the necessary software. Pleases users and the quality of the IPS-display with a diagonal of just under 24 inches. As for the obvious shortcomings, most often in the reviews, they complain about not the best sounding of the speakers, the non-standard arrangement of buttons on the standard keyboard, and general minor flaws in ergonomics – inconvenient location of some of the ports, screen soiled, etc.

3. HP 24 i5 1035G1

HP 24 I5 1035G1

A high-performance office 24-inch all-in-one PC capable of handling graphics and simple video editing. Built around a 4-core processor with an integrated graphics core and 8GB of RAM. At the same time, the model provides ample opportunities for upgrading – there is a second slot for RAM and two M.2 slots so that the basic SSD can be easily supplemented with a spacious HDD. The screen does not rouse any criticism, and its diagonal of 23.8 inches is quite enough for working with documents of any type. The reviews mention the possible noise of the cooling system under high loads, as well as the lack of USB ports – there are only 4 of them, so you will have to buy a hub because a couple of ports will immediately be occupied by the wired mouse and keyboard included in the package.

2. HP 24 i5 10400T: most productive processor

HP 24 I5 10400T

Entry-level all-in-one gaming PC with a 6-core processor and discrete with 2 GB of video memory. In addition, there are 8 GB of base RAM and a smart SSD on board, while the RAM can be increased by another 8 GB thanks to the second slot, and the SSD can be supplemented with a second drive since there is an additional M.2 slot. The 23.8-inch IPS display has a top-notch picture but requires factory calibration out of the box. Another problem will be the regular keyboard and mouse, the quality of which is criticized by most buyers, so you should immediately consider replacing them.

1. HP 24 i5 9400T: most popular mid-budget all-in-one

HP 24 I5 9400T

Mid-budget candy bar mainly for office work and simple entertainment at home. It has a discrete graphics card onboard, plus a 6-core processor, so it is quite suitable for undemanding games at least at medium graphics settings. The display is classic – 23.8 inches diagonal, a good IPS matrix, and a decent margin of backlight brightness. There is a second RAM slot for the upgrade, so the base 8 GB can be easily doubled. Among the shortcomings in the reviews, the most often mentioned is not the quietest cooling system, but some are helped by BIOS reconfiguration. Among the other problems, let us single out the small number of USB ports, half of which are immediately “eaten” by the mouse and keyboard. In addition, the white plastic of the case gets dirty very quickly.
